We had the same...
and we discovered that the LU reject cause was changed. Then, the mobile phone kept on doing LU !!!
I went to simulate on the old TEMS900 those LU reject causes and it is true... I dont quite recall now but if you have PLMN invalid as reject cause the phone KEEPS on doing LU attempts. So after a huge fuzz core people never explained why happened but they fixed it with a patch very fast....
Im not saying is your problem, just to let you know that the phone behaves differently in regards the LU_reject cause
